Design and display: how the hinge and screen work in concert

At its core, the 6.85-inch AMOLEDThe main screen offers bright, punchy colors with respectable outdoor legibility. When folded, the handset becomes a pocketable device optimized for one-handed use. The hinge is the star here: a robust metal alloy framework paired with an inner reinforcement minimizes wobble and wear out to the first few thousand folds. Expect dependable performance in daily tasks, watching videos, and quick multitasking, with a design that prioritizes durabilityoath compactnessover flashy flex modes.

Performance and RAM: real-world usability with 6 GB RAM

Powered by MediaTek MT6789The device handles everyday apps, social media, and streaming with ease. The combination of 6GB RAMoath 128 GB storagehits a sweet spot for the regional market, offering smooth app switching and ample space for media. In practice, you’ll enjoy fluid navigation and snappy launch times for routine tasks. However, expect occasional slowdowns with heavy gaming or extreme multitasking—this is where software optimization and task management become crucial for sustaining a seamless experience.

Battery and charging: does 3750 mAh cover a full day?

3,750mAhis typical for foldables in this range. The AMOLED display and MT6789’s efficiency work in tandem to squeeze out a full day under moderate use. If you stream high-definition video for hours or play graphics-heavy titles, expect to reach the charger before bedtime. Fast charging support and efficient charging hardware can tilt daily endurance in your favor, especially with a practical charger in the box and reputable third-party options.
